AJLLJ Portrait Database 5 Aug 2011
Martha Levy and her sister Henrietta were the daughters of Mary Pearce and Judge Moses Levy. Their father was a very successful judge and lawyer, and the girls grew up in the highest rungs of Philadelphia's Protestant elite. Although they were the great granddaughters of Moses Levy, among the founders of American Jewry, this branch of the Levy family had been Episcopalian for several generations.
| Levy, Martha Mary Ann (I1145)

At the outbreak of the American Revolution Phillips favored the patriot cause; and he was an ardent supporter of the Non-Importation Agreement in 1770. In 1776 he used his influence in the New York congregation to close the doors of the synagogue and remove rather than continue under the British . The edifice was abandoned; and, with the majority of the congregation, Phillips removed to Philadelphia, where he continued in business until 1778. In that year he joined the Revolutionary army, serving in the Philadelphia Militia under Colonel Bradford. | Phillips, Jonas (I2680)

AUTO VICTIM DIES THURSDAY EVENING Mrs. Florine Loeb Succumbs to Injuries; Wright Charged with Manslaughter
Mrs. Florine Loeb, died at 6 o'clock Thursday night at a local hospital, where she had not quitted her bed since she was struck by an automobile last Monday.
Ernest Wright, 16-year-old school boy driver of the car which is said to have struck Mrs. Loeb, near Court Street Methodist church, was arrested two hours after the latter's death. He was later released in $1,000 bail, charged with manslaughter. Hearing for Wright in police court was set for the evening of December 20.
When a change was noted in the condition of Mrs. Loeb during the early morning, police officials visited Sidney Lanier High School and carried Wright to headquarters, where he was later released. Prior to the detention of Wright he had been free in bail on a charge of collision preferred the night of the running down of the victim.
Mrs. Loeb was a native of Reichshoffen, Alsace, France, coming to Montgomery when but a young woman. She was married to the late Leon Loeb in 1858 and during the many years of her residence in Montgomery won the esteem of a large circle of friends who will be grieved to learn of her death.
She was a member of Temple Beth Or, the Hebrew Ladies' Benevolent Society and the Council of Jewish Women.
Mrs. Loeb is survived by two daughters, Misses Carrie and Adele Loeb, and one son, Ralph Loeb, all of Montgomery; one sister, Mrs. Emelie Winter of Philadelphia, Pa., and one brother, Michael Loeb of Montgomery.
The funeral services will be held from the residence, 221 Clayton Street, at 2 o'clock Friday afternoon. Rabbi William B. Schwartz officiating. Interment will be at Oakwood. Montgomery Advertiser | Loeb, Florine (I5295)
